Cricket association of Bihar urges SC to make names in final probe report public

New Delhi, Nov 26 (ANI): Cricket association of Bihar has urged the Supreme Court to make the names of cricketers mentioned in the final probe report of Indian Premier League (IPL) scam public in the interest of the sport. Advocate Harish Salve, appearing for Cricket Association of Bihar (CAB), asked the Supreme Court to disclose the full Mudgal committee report while also producing in the court IPL accreditation documents that show Gurunath Meiyappan as the team principal of Chennai Super Kings (CSK). Petitioner Aditya Verma said he has full faith in the court to deliver justice in the case. The Supreme Court had relieved Srinivasan of his duties as the country's cricket board president to ensure a fair investigation into the IPL scam, in which Meiyappan was indicted for illegal betting on the 2013 IPL. MEA says India's emphasis will be on meaningful dialogue with Pakistan

Kathmandu, Nov 26 (ANI): India's Foreign Ministry has said that New Delhi's emphasis would be on conducting a meaningful dialogue with Islamabad at the 18th SAARC Summit in Nepal. Addressing a news conference, India's Foreign Ministry Spokesperson, Syed Akbaruddin replying to a query on dialogue between India and Pakistan said that New Delhi had always welcomed a meaningful dialogue with the nuclear-armed neighbour.
